I'm not sure I have a solid grasp on >> why we're doing milestones in tc9 (other than to prevent a bunch of >> revisions from being releases pre-beta) so this might need some >> changes to convey the intent a bit better. > > Version numbers aren't the concern. > > Think of it as: > - Milestone - Specification JARs not complete > - Alpha - Specification JARs complete, other stuff (including the > implementation of the specification) not complete > - Beta - Feature complete, not production ready > - Stable - Production ready > > Once the spec is final getting to Alpha is pretty easy. Historically, we > haven't been this far ahead of the curve before. We've usually been > playing catch up so we've started with Alpha. > > Does that help? >
